An expert locksmith can use a series of services to help you with your car keys. Here are a few of the most typical services:
Key Duplication: This service includes developing a precise copy of your existing car key. It's straightforward for traditional metal keys however can be more complex for keys with electronic parts.Key Programming: Many modern-day cars and trucks have transponder keys that require to be programmed to the vehicle's computer system. A locksmith can program a new key to guarantee it works perfectly with your car.Key Extraction: If your key breaks off in the lock, a locksmith can securely remove it without causing damage to the lock or the vehicle.Lock Repair and Replacement: If your car lock is harmed or malfunctioning, a locksmith can repair or replace it, ensuring that your vehicle stays protected.Emergency Lockout Assistance: In the event that you are locked out of your car, a locksmith can supply quick and efficient assistance to get you back in.Tips for Choosing the Right LocksmithExamine Credentials: Verify that the locksmith is certified and licensed. Q: How much does a locksmith generally charge for car key services?A: The cost can vary depending on the service and the locksmith. Key duplication for a traditional metal key can cost in between ₤ 10 and ₤ 50, while programming a transponder key can vary from ₤ 50 to ₤ 150. Emergency services may be more pricey, however many locksmiths offer flat rates or discounts.

Q: Can a locksmith replace a lost key fob?A: Yes, a professional locksmith can replace a lost key fob. They can program a brand-new fob to work with your vehicle's system, frequently at a lower cost than a dealer.

Q: What should I do if my key breaks in the lock?A: If your key breaks in the lock, do not try to require it out. Call a locksmith who can securely extract the broken piece and produce a brand-new key for you.

Q: Are locksmiths readily available 24/7?A: Many cheap locksmith for Car keys near me professionals offer 24/7 emergency services. It's an excellent idea to inquire about their accessibility when you contact them.

Q: How long does it consider a locksmith to show up?A: The arrival time can differ depending upon the locksmith's schedule and your location. Most locksmith professionals intend to arrive within 30 minutes to an hour.

Q: Can a locksmith assist with keyless entry systems?A: Yes, a locksmith can assist with keyless entry systems. They can diagnose problems, replace batteries, and reprogram the system if essential.
